Magnesium is a vital mineral involved in over 300 enzymatic reactions in the body, influencing everything from muscle and nerve function to blood sugar control and energy production. Despite its importance, magnesium deficiency is common, driving many to seek supplementation. However, not all magnesium supplements are created equal. The form of magnesium—the compound it's bound to—significantly impacts its bioavailability, target area in the body, and intended benefits. Two of the most popular and bioavailable forms are magnesium threonate and magnesium glycinate, but they serve different primary purposes.

What is Magnesium Threonate?

Magnesium L-threonate is a specialized and patented form of magnesium that has been extensively studied for its unique ability to cross the blood-brain barrier effectively. This allows it to increase magnesium levels directly within the brain's cerebrospinal fluid, impacting neurological function in a way other forms cannot. It was developed by scientists at MIT to target brain health specifically.

Benefits of Magnesium Threonate

  • Enhances cognitive function: By increasing magnesium concentration in the brain, it supports synaptic density and plasticity, which are crucial for learning and memory formation.
  • Improves memory and focus: Studies show it can help improve short-term and working memory, as well as focus and concentration.
  • Supports restorative sleep: While it works differently than glycinate, threonate can help quiet racing thoughts, promoting a more relaxed mental state that supports deep sleep stages like REM.
  • Reduces anxiety and stress-related fatigue: By modulating neurotransmitters and supporting neural connections, it can contribute to a calmer mental state.

What is Magnesium Glycinate?

Magnesium glycinate is formed by binding magnesium to the amino acid glycine. This chelation process enhances its absorption in the intestines and makes it very gentle on the stomach, unlike some other forms that can cause laxative effects. Glycine itself is an inhibitory neurotransmitter that promotes relaxation, giving this form a synergistic effect.

Benefits of Magnesium Glycinate

  • Promotes relaxation and sleep: The calming effects of glycine combined with magnesium's role in regulating neurotransmitters like GABA make it highly effective for promoting relaxation and better sleep onset.
  • Reduces anxiety and stress: It helps regulate cortisol and calm the nervous system, which is beneficial for managing anxiety and physical tension.
  • Replenishes overall magnesium levels: Due to its high bioavailability and excellent absorption, magnesium glycinate is a great choice for correcting systemic magnesium deficiency.
  • Eases muscle cramps and tension: As a natural muscle relaxant, it can help relieve muscle tightness and spasms, which are often related to low magnesium levels.

How to Choose the Right Magnesium for You

The choice depends heavily on your primary health goals. Ask yourself what you want to achieve with magnesium supplementation:

  • If your main struggle is with brain fog, poor memory, difficulty focusing, or age-related cognitive decline, magnesium threonate is the more targeted option. It is specifically designed to optimize brain magnesium levels and support long-term neurological health.
  • If you primarily need relief from stress, anxiety, muscle tension, or difficulty falling asleep due to a racing mind, magnesium glycinate is the ideal choice. Its combination with glycine provides a profound calming effect on both the mind and body.
  • If your goal is simply to correct a magnesium deficiency and you have no specific cognitive or relaxation concerns, magnesium glycinate's excellent systemic absorption and tolerance make it a great all-around option.

Can You Take Both Magnesium Threonate and Glycinate?

Yes, many people find it beneficial to take both forms to address different needs simultaneously. You could, for example, take magnesium glycinate in the evening to promote sleep and relaxation, and magnesium threonate earlier in the day to support cognitive function and focus. This strategy allows you to harness the specific benefits of each form for a more comprehensive approach to your health. Always consult a healthcare professional before starting any new supplement regimen, especially if you plan to combine different forms.

Potential Side Effects and Safety

Both forms of magnesium are generally well-tolerated. The most common side effect of magnesium supplementation, in general, is gastrointestinal discomfort such as diarrhea, but magnesium glycinate is known to be particularly gentle on the digestive system. High doses of any magnesium supplement can increase the risk of side effects, so it is best to start with a lower dose and increase gradually if needed. If you have kidney problems, it is especially important to consult a healthcare provider before taking magnesium supplements, as excess magnesium can build up to dangerous levels.
